Parking. There are never enough parking spaces, and people have been known to be late to class because they had to search and/or wait for an available space. The campus is in a somewhat remote location, so there isn't any other nearby available parking.

I feel that my school has a bad reputation due to it being a community college. Certain people, my parents included, feel that I'm not getting a quality experience or the same education as my peers attending a four year university. I am afraid that train of thought might be a common misconception and that it could hurt my chances of getting a job in the future if I am competing against the "unversity" graduates.
